Subject: Re: Undefined Node Type
Sender: nalex@parallelgraphics.com 21.05.07 12:30

1. Add declaration of extern proto to VRML syntax for Browser.createVrmlFromString method. This makes string to be self-contained as required by VRML97 specification.

2. Use an alternative version of createVrmlFromString:
Browser.Cortona_createVrmlFromString
In this case there is no need to prepend extern proto declaration to VRML syntax since proto was declared in scene. Please note that this method is available in Cortona VRML Client since version 5 and does not supported by other VRML viewers.
